如何将maven项目打包成可执行的jar
来源:互联网 发布:adsafe软件不能安装 编辑:程序博客网 时间:2024/05/02 00:10
maven项目如何执行main方法
请参考http://mojo.codehaus.org/exec-maven-plugin/
方法一:将项目及所依赖的所有jar包打包成一个jar。
1、pom.xml添加assembly插件
2、执行mvn assembly:assembly
3、生成如下文件
4、执行java -jar quickstart-1.0.0-jar-with-dependencies.jar
备注:第2步的命令也可以改成mvn package,但需要更改pom.xml:
方法二:将项目依赖的jar复制到一个目录中并在MANIFEST文件中添加Class-Path和Main-Class。
1、在pom.xml中添加jar和dependency插件
2、执行mvn package
3、生成如下文件
4、执行java -jar quickstart-1.0.0.jar
0 0
- 如何将maven项目打包成可执行的jar
- 如何将maven项目打包成可执行的jar
- 如何将maven项目打包成可执行的jar
- 如何将maven项目打包成可执行的jar
- 如何将maven项目打包成可执行的jar
- 如何将maven项目打包成可执行的jar
- 如何将maven项目打包成可执行的jar
- 如何将maven项目打包成可执行的jar
- 如何将maven项目打包成可执行的jar
- 如何将maven项目打包成可执行的jar
- 如何将maven项目打包成可执行的jar
- 如何利用maven将maven项目打包成可执行的jar
- 将maven项目打包成可执行的jar
- 如何不通过maven或者ant将项目打包成可执行的Jar包
- 如何将maven项目包含工程依赖打包成可执行的jar
- Maven项目打包成可执行的jar
- maven项目打包成可执行的jar
- 将Maven项目打包成可执行jar文件(引用第三方jar)-支持Spring的项目
- 自己动手写CPU之第五阶段(4)——逻辑、移位与空指令的实现
- Java 单线程写文件 多线程读文件
- tatic/final/autoboxing/数据转换,异常处理等知识!
- Qt自定义委托在QTableView中绘制控件、图片、文字
- ibatis中多表联接查询
- 如何将maven项目打包成可执行的jar
- MAC 上的.bash_profile文件
- PropertyPlaceholderConfigurer的用法
- django模板页闪现信息
- web.xml不认taglib标签的解决方法
- 中国企业决战的新焦点--品牌战略
- UVA 116 - Unidirectional TSP(被这个题坑了)
- Spring的几个常用的Bean声明
- mysql5.6.19下子查询无法使用索引的疑问的疑问